About 4 St Leonards Road
4 St Leonards Road is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Horfield, Bristol, Bristol (BS7 8SH). It has a recorded floor area of 89 m² (around 958 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2022)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in December 2008 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 88). Period features are noted in the property record.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Last sale on file: £545,000 in June 2023.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 71% of similar EPCs). Across 2007–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.3%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£569/sq ft) was about 154.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
